Determine the value of f(2) for the function f(x) = x^3+18x^2+99x+162 for x < -3...

The value of f(2) for the function f(x) is f(2) = 0.
Since f(x) = x³ + 18x² + 99x + 162 for x < -3
f(x) = (3x - 6)/(x² - 7x + 6) for -3 < x ≤ 2
f(x) = √(x² - 4) for x > 2
Since we require f(2) and the expression in the middle covers the range -3 < x ≤ 2, so we use this expression.
f(x) = (3x - 6)/(x² - 7x + 6)
So, f(2) = (3(2) - 6)/((2)² - 7(2) + 6)
f(2) = (6 - 6)/(4 - 14 + 6)
f(2) = 0/-4
f(2) = 0
So, the value of f(2) for the function f(x) is f(2) = 0.
